I don't think Kirk is the answer. With the way MA wants to play, he's putting together a midfield that can pick a pass. Unfortunately our forwards, and in particular our wide players, like the ball to feet and then to run with the ball. What we need are some forwards/wingers that constantly make good runs, good movement off the ball to give the likes of Fiorini and Patino options when they receive the ball, and to pull the opposition defence about a bit. Currently, it's a bit too static, predictable and easy to defend against. We're effectively relying on Bowler to beat 3 or 4 players every game to create opportunities, and 95% of the time that's going to fail against championship defences.
It's not often we see a forward making a run, and a midfielder playing a through ball to run onto. The only player we have who does make runs is Yates, who I still think will thrive in the system given time and a bit of confidence. Actually Lavery did a couple of times on Saturday too, and we saw better movement in general in the second half. But it can still improve massively. All our forwards need to adjust as we change the way we play.
